Doodle Hex scribbles onto DS

Magically themed strategy game from Tragnarion Studios noted for Nintendo's portable in early 2008.

Last month, Tragnarion Studios unveiled its first game, The Scourge Project. Powered by Epic Games' Unreal Engine 3, the ambitious, story-driven first-person shooter aims to emphasize team-based gameplay, and will be available on the Xbox 360, PlayStation 3, and PC sometime in 2008.

While The Scourge Project was the developer's first game to be announced, it might not be the first game on the market from Tragnarion. Today, the Palma de Mallorca, Spain-based studio announced it will be shipping Doodle Hex exclusively for the Nintendo DS in early 2008.

According to today's announcement, Doodle Hex requires players to exercise "speed of thought, tactical choices, and accurate drawing" to succeed. Players will compete in a series of duels by drawing magical runes on the DS's touch screen. The game features more than 200 different runes, with powers ranging from damage spells to counterattacks to polymorphisms. Players can square off in single-player and multiplayer modes that occur in real time, and also trade found runes using the DS's Wi-Fi capabilities.
